I was hospitalized with a life threatening infection last year. While fighting for my life - and accumulating 100's of thou$ands of dollars in ...medical bills - there were 2 occasions where my payments were 2 DAYS LATE. Of course, I paid the late fees and the service charges.
After 7 years with Diners Club I had accumulated 119,000 rewards points (redeemable for gifts or airline miles). After being 2 DAYS LATE for the second time, they closed my account and forced me to pay within 60 days to avaoid collection. OK, no problem, screw you very much.
Now, they have STOLEN my rewards points. After telling me I had until September 30 to transfer the points (why is there a time limit at all...anyone?) I called today to transfer and they tell me my deadline was September 12th. I'm really broiling here. This is outright theft.
